summaryrefslogtreecommitdiffstats
path: root/src/gallium/targets/xorg-vmwgfx
diff options
context:
space:
mode:
authorThomas Hellstrom <[email protected]>2010-10-12 14:10:50 +0200
committerThomas Hellstrom <[email protected]>2010-10-12 15:09:05 +0200
commit201c3d36697fccfee6b6dacf9529d1951f77651c (patch)
tree40d482c3266118ac50211e2ffddb85645584c9f0 /src/gallium/targets/xorg-vmwgfx
parentbfd065c71ed6df1e1ce1a2a7e6bcf6bdacac38d4 (diff)
xorg/vmwgfx: Don't hide HW cursors when updating them
Gets rid of annoying cursor flicker Signed-off-by: Thomas Hellstrom <[email protected]>
Diffstat (limited to 'src/gallium/targets/xorg-vmwgfx')
-rw-r--r--src/gallium/targets/xorg-vmwgfx/vmw_screen.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/gallium/targets/xorg-vmwgfx/vmw_screen.c b/src/gallium/targets/xorg-vmwgfx/vmw_screen.c
index 8173908f551..76622031650 100644
--- a/src/gallium/targets/xorg-vmwgfx/vmw_screen.c
+++ b/src/gallium/targets/xorg-vmwgfx/vmw_screen.c
@@ -245,6 +245,7 @@ vmw_screen_pre_init(ScrnInfoPtr pScrn, int flags)
cust->winsys_enter_vt = vmw_screen_enter_vt;
cust->winsys_leave_vt = vmw_screen_leave_vt;
cust->no_3d = TRUE;
+ cust->unhidden_hw_cursor_update = TRUE;
vmw->pScrn = pScrn;
pScrn->driverPrivate = cust;